BACKGROUND: Holoprosencephaly is the most frequent congenital malformation of the forebrain in humans. It is anatomically classified by the relative degree of abnormal formation and separation of the developing central nervous system. Mutations of ZIC2 are the second most common heterozygous variations detected in holoprosencephaly (HPE) patients. Mutations in most known HPE genes typically result in variable phenotypes that rage from classic alobar HPE to microforms represented by hypotelorism, solitary central maxillary incisor (SCMI), and cleft lip/palate, among others. Patients with HPE owing to ZIC2 mutations have recently been described by a distinct phenotype compared with mutations in other HPE causative genes. METHODS: We report the comparison of ZIC2 molecular findings by Sanger bidirectional DNA sequencing and ad hoc genotyping in a cohort of 105 Brazilian patients within the clinical spectrum of HPE, including classic and microform groups. RESULTS: We detected a total of five variants in the ZIC2 gene: a common histidine tract expansion c.716_718dup (p.His239dup), a rare c.1377_1391del_homozygous (p.Ala466_470del, or Ala 15 to 10 contraction), a novel intronic c.1239+18G>A variant, a novel frameshift c.1215dupC (p.Ser406Glnfs*11), and a c.1401_1406dup (p.Ala469_470dup, or alanine tract expansion to 17 residues). CONCLUSIONS: From these patients, only the latter two mutations found in classic HPE are likely to be medically significant. In contrast, variants detected in the microform group are not likely to be pathogenic. We show conclusively that the histidine tract expansion is a polymorphic alteration that demonstrates considerable differences in allele frequencies across different ethnic groups. Therefore, careful population studies of rare variants can improve genotype-phenotype correlations. Birth Defects Research (Part A) 2012.

Here we report on the clinical and genetic data for a large sample of Brazilian patients studied at the Hospital de Reabilitação de Anomalas Craniofaciais-Universidade de São Paulo (HRAC-USP) who presented with either the classic holoprosencephaly or the holoprosencephaly-like (HPE-L) phenotype. The sample included patients without detected mutations in some HPE determinant genes such as SHH, GLI2, SIX3, TGIF, and PTCH, as well as the photographic documentation of the previously reported patients in our Center. The HPE-L phenotype has been also called of HPE "minor forms" or "microforms." The variable phenotype, the challenge of genetic counseling, and the similarities to patients with isolated cleft lip/palate are discussed.

Holoprosencephaly (HPE) is genetically heterogeneous. Variable phenotypic manifestations within families with normal and affected patients have been attributed to the number and type of HPE gene mutations. Environmental agents may also contribute to the severity as well as the requirement of multiple hits. Clinical expression is extremely variable ranging from minor facial signs to complex craniofacial anomalies such as cyclopia. Main genes involved include SHH, GLI2, PTCH1, TGIF, ZIC2, TDGF1, SIX3; however, several other candidates have been proposed. Recently it was established that the human growth arrest specific gene 1 (GAS1) is a potential locus for several human craniofacial malformations. Here, we report on four Brazilian patients with GAS1 DNA sequence change who presented variable phenotypical manifestations ranging from classic HPE to HPE-like signs. Two patients had single DNA sequence change in the GAS1 gene, while in other two, an additional mutation in the SHH gene was observed. Clinical manifestations presented by these patients suggest that GAS1 could be considered a candidate locus for one of the types of human HPE.

We describe a Brazilian boy with semilobar holoprosencephaly, ectrodactyly, bilateral cleft of lip and palate, and severe mental retardation. The karyotype was normal and the screening for mutations in the genes SHH, TGIF, SIX3, GLI2, TP73L, and DHCR7 did not show any change. This rare condition was described previously in seven male patients. Clinical and genetic aspects are discussed.

The etiologies and clinical spectra of HPE are extremely heterogeneous. Here, we report a Brazilian boy with lobar holoprosencephaly who was ascertained in a sample of 60 patients with HPE and HPE-like phenotypes and screened for molecular analysis of the major HPE causative genes: SHH, PTCH, SIX3, GLI2, and TGIF. This boy presented a p.K44N (c.132G>T) mutation in exon 2 of the TGIF gene which was inherited from his phenotypically normal mother. This mutation leads to lysine to arginine amino acid change and is predicted to be a damaging mutation. Clinical aspects involving variable phenotypical manifestations in different mutations of TGIF are discussed.

BACKGROUND: Cleft lip or palate (or the two in combination) is a common birth defect that results from a mixture of genetic and environmental factors. We searched for a specific genetic factor contributing to this complex trait by examining large numbers of affected patients and families and evaluating a specific candidate gene. METHODS: We identified the gene that encodes interferon regulatory factor 6 (IRF6) as a candidate gene on the basis of its involvement in an autosomal dominant form of cleft lip and palate, Van der Woude's syndrome. A single-nucleotide polymorphism in this gene results in either a valine or an isoleucine at amino acid position 274 (V274I). We carried out transmission-disequilibrium testing for V274I in 8003 individual subjects in 1968 families derived from 10 populations with ancestry in Asia, Europe, and South America, haplotype and linkage analyses, and case-control analyses, and determined the risk of cleft lip or palate that is associated with genetic variation in IRF6. RESULTS: Strong evidence of overtransmission of the valine (V) allele was found in the entire population data set (P<10(-9)); moreover, the results for some individual populations from South America and Asia were highly significant. Variation at IRF6 was responsible for 12 percent of the genetic contribution to cleft lip or palate and tripled the risk of recurrence in families that had already had one affected child. CONCLUSIONS: DNA-sequence variants associated with IRF6 are major contributors to cleft lip, with or without cleft palate. The contribution of variants in single genes to cleft lip or palate is an important consideration in genetic counseling.

BACKGROUND: familial dyslexia. AIM: to characterize and compare the phonological awareness, working memory, reading and writing abilities of individuals whose family members are also affected. METHOD: in this study 10 familial nuclei of natural family relationship of individuals with dyslexia were analyzed. Families of natural individuals living in the west region of the state of São Paulo were selected. Inclusion criteria were: to be a native speaker of the Brazilian Portuguese language, to have 8 years of age or more, to present positive familial history for learning disabilities, that is, to present at least one relative with difficulties in learning. Exclusion criteria were: to present any neurological disorder genetically caused or not, in any of the family members, such as dystonia, extra pyramidal diseases, mental disorder, epilepsy, attention deficit and hyperactivity disorder (ADHA); psychiatric symptoms or conditions; or any other pertinent conditions that could cause errors in the diagnosis. As for the diagnosis of developmental dyslexia, information about the familial history of the adolescents and children was gathered with the parents, so that a detailed pedigree could be delineated. Neurological, psychological, speech-language, and school performance evaluations were made with the individuals and their families. RESULTS: the results of this study suggest that the dyslexic individuals and their respective relatives, also with dyslexia, presented lower performances than the control group in terms of rapid automatic naming, reading, writing and phonological awareness. CONCLUSION: deficits in phonological awareness, working memory, reading and writing seem to have genetic susceptibility that possibly determine, when in interaction with the environment, the manifestation of dyslexia.

Congenital malformations involving the face, oral cavity, and digits are the main findings in the oro-facio-digital (OFD) syndromes. Various eye anomalies and central nervous system involvement have also been reported in this condition. Here we report on a Brazilian boy with features belonging to the clinical spectrum of the OFD syndromes. He also had additional findings of periventricular nodular heterotopia (PVNH), asymmetric limb involvement, and microphthalmia. This unusual pattern of anomalies has not been reported previously and appears to be unique.

Coding region alterations of ZIC2 are the second most common type of mutation in holoprosencephaly (HPE). Here we use several complementary bioinformatic approaches to identify ultraconserved cis-regulatory sequences potentially driving the expression of human ZIC2. We demonstrate that an 804 bp element in the 3' untranslated region (3'UTR) is highly conserved across the evolutionary history of vertebrates from fish to humans. Furthermore, we show that while genetic variation of this element is unexpectedly common among holoprosencephaly subjects (6/528 or >1%), it is not present in control individuals. Two of six proband-unique variants are de novo, supporting their pathogenic involvement in HPE outcomes. These findings support a general recommendation that the identification and analysis of key ultraconserved elements should be incorporated into the genetic risk assessment of holoprosencephaly cases.

Here we report on a Brazilian female patient with the clinical manifestations of the holoprosencephaly-like phenotype who also presented with a retroocular granuloma diagnosed as Langerhans cell histiocytosis in early infancy. Mutation analysis showed a missense mutation (G316D) in the exon 2 of SIX3 gene, which was predicted as damaged by the PolyPhen program. We discuss the clinical and genetic aspects of this unusual case.

OBJECTIVE: First and second branchial arch involvement during early embryonic development results in a wide spectrum of anomalies that encompass diverse, superimposed, and heterogeneous phenotypes within the so-called oculoauriculovertebral spectrum. Nine members of a Brazilian family presenting typical branchial arch involvement in association with external opthalmoplegia are reported. CONCLUSION: Macrostomia or abnormal mouth contour, preauricular tags, and uni- or bilateral ptosis were present in association in several patients. To our knowledge, this is the first report on this type of autosomal dominant condition. Clinical and genetic aspects are discussed.

We report 22 patients with normal neuropsychological development and a holoprosencephaly-like (HPE-like) phenotype screened for SHH, SIX3, TGIF, and GLI2. These patients were divided into two groups: (1) 6 patients with SHH and GLI2 mutations and (2) 16 patients with no detectable mutations. We discuss the phenotypic manifestations, evolution of the phenotype, and neuroimaging in the two groups. Conclusions about the HPE-like phenotype include (1) initial appearance as an unusually wide, and very severe unilateral cleft lip-palate in some cases; (2) variability with the expression of minor anomalies in some cases, such as single maxillary central incisor; (3) identifiable mutations in some cases and absence of mutations in others; (4) essentially normal MRI in the most cases (pituitary tumor in two cases and choroid fissure cyst in one case in Group 1; empty sella turcica in one case in Group 2); (5) intelligence within the normal range; and (6) familial aggregation in some instances. Implications include (1) thorough examination of family members for minor anomalies; (2) MRI and developmental assessment for the proband; and (3) molecular analysis.

Three patients--one with alobar holoprosencephaly and two with a holoprosencephaly-like phenotype--are reported with no identifiable mutations. In each case, one parent had a single maxillary central incisor (SMCI). We briefly review the holoprosencephaly-like phenotype and present a table of 25 conditions with SMCI.

We report five Brazilian probands with PATCHED (PTCH) mutations and highly variable phenotypes with holoprosencephaly in four cases and holoprosencephaly-like facial features with a normal MRI in a fifth case. Three of our mutations were novel: Ala443Gly, Val751Gly, and Val908Gly. Two patients had the same mutation (Val908Gly), but were phenotypically different: alobar holoprosencephaly, absent nasal septum, and midline cleft lip-palate in one case, and lobar holoprosencephaly, macrocephaly, hypertelorism, clefting of the nose, severe microphthalmia, and a single maxillary central incisor in the other. One of our patients had a Thr1052Met mutation, holoprosencephaly-like facial features, and a normal MRI. Ming et al. [(2002); Hum Genet 110:297-301] reported an identical mutation, but with alobar holoprosencephaly.

We report four patients with GLI2 mutations together with their associated phenotypes: (1) holoprosencephaly-like phenotype, (2) anophthalmia, branchial arch anomalies, and CNS abnormalities, (3) heminasal aplasia and orbital anomalies, and (4) lobar holoprosencephaly. This diversity of phenotypes expands our understanding. Findings include not only (1) holoprosencephaly or a holoprosencephaly-like phenotype, but also (2) heminasal aplasia with orbital anomalies, and (3) branchial arch anomalies of the type seen in hemifacial microsomia with anophthalmia and in oculoauriculofrontonasal syndrome. Finally, this is the first report of a double mutation involving GLI2 and PTCH in the same patient.

Here, we report six Brazilian patients with holoprosencephaly caused by SIX3 mutations. Missense mutations were more common than frameshift mutations. Comparison of patients with missense versus frameshift mutations was essentially unremarkable. Our cases suggest that SIX3 mutations result in a more severe phenotype than other gene mutations for holoprosencephaly. One patient had a double SIX3 mutation, which has not been reported previously. In our SIX3 mutations, three were transmitted by the paternal side, two were transmitted by the maternal side, and one was a de novo event. Mutations in normal parents with severe involvement of their offspring does not allow prediction of phenotypic severity, which makes genetic counseling difficult.

This study evaluated audiological and electrophysiological profiles in 13 patients with holoprosencephaly. All patients had imaging evaluation by magnetic resonance imaging and molecular screening for the genes SHH, GLI2, and SIX3. Each patient underwent clinical (otological and vestibular antecedents, otoscopy) and instrumental (tympanometry, auditory brainstem response--ABR) evaluation to compare hearing and the electrophysiological profile possibly occurring in patients with these mutations. To our knowledge there are no systematic studies correlating molecular/imaging and evoked potentials in patients with HPE. Here, we discuss the audiological and electrophysiological profiles of patients and the possible role of the genes studied on the overall findings.

Here, we evaluate linguistic skills and neuropsychological performance in a sample of patients with SHH mutations and a holoprosencephaly (HPE)-like phenotype, a minor form of classic HPE. Our findings suggest that patients with SHH mutations and a HPE-like phenotype have normal cognitive ratios and significant language impairment. Imaging evaluation by magnetic resonance imaging (MRI) was normal in three patients and in one there was hypoplasia of the anterior commissure and the presence of a temporal cyst, apparently not related to the clinical findings.

TEMA: dislexia familial. OBJETIVO: caracterizar o desempenho em consciência fonológica, memória operacional, leitura e escrita do probando com dislexia e de seus familiares afetados. MÉTODO: participaram deste estudo 10 núcleos familiais de parentesco natural de indivíduos com queixa específica de problemas de leitura e compreensão. Foram selecionadas famílias de probandos naturais e residentes na região do oeste do estado de São Paulo. Os requisitos de inclusão dos probandos foram: ser falante nativo do Português Brasileiro, ter idade acima de oito anos, apresentar histórico familial positivo para os problemas de aprendizagem, ou seja, apresentar no mínimo um outro parente com dificuldade para aprender em três gerações. Os critérios de exclusão para o grupo de probandos foram: apresentar qualquer distúrbio neurológico-genético tais como distonia, doenças extras piramidais, deficiência mental, epilepsia, transtorno do déficit de atenção e hiperatividade (TDAH); sintomas ou condições psiquiátricas; ou outras condições pertinentes que poderiam gerar erros no diagnóstico. Para o diagnóstico de dislexia do desenvolvimento foram coletados dados de antecedente familial na histórica clínica com os pais das crianças e adolescentes para realização do heredograma. Foram realizadas avaliações neurológica, fonoaudiológica, psicológica e de desempenho escolar nos probandos e em seus parentes. RESULTADOS: os resultados deste estudo sugeriram que os probandos e seus familiares com dislexia apresentaram desempenho inferior ao grupo controle quanto à nomeação rápida, leitura, escrita e consciência fonológica. CONCLUSÃO: alterações em consciência fonológica, memória de trabalho, leitura e escrita tem susceptibilidade genética que possivelmente em interação com o meio ambiente determinam o quadro de dislexia.
